Tyndale Bible (1526/1534)
Martha sayde vnto him: I knowe that he shall ryse agayne in the resurreccion at the last daye.
Coverdale Bible (1535)
Martha sayde vnto hi: I knowe, yt he shal ryse agayne in the resurreccion at ye last daye.
Geneva Bible (1560)
Martha said vnto him, I know that he shall rise againe in the resurrection at the last day.
Bishops' Bible (1568)
Martha sayth vnto hym: I knowe that he shall ryse agayne in the resurrection at the last day.
Authorized King James Version (1611)
Martha saith unto him, I know that he shall rise again in the resurrection at the last day.
Webster's Bible (1833)
Martha said to him, "I know that he will rise again in the resurrection at the last day."
Young's Literal Translation (1862/1898)
Martha saith to him, `I have known that he will rise again, in the rising again in the last day;'
American Standard Version (1901)
Martha saith unto him, I know that he shall rise again in the resurrection at the last day.
Bible in Basic English (1941)
Martha said to him, I am certain that he will come to life again when all come back from the dead at the last day.
World English Bible (2000)
Martha said to him, "I know that he will rise again in the resurrection at the last day."
NET Bible® (New English Translation)
Martha said,“I know that he will come back to life again in the resurrection at the last day.”
